Roof leaks may be a result of many different aspects, like age, weather conditions injury, inadequate installation, and not enough maintenance. As a roof ages, the materials can deteriorate, bringing about cracks, gaps, and weakened regions that let water to seep through. On top of that, intense climatic conditions including hefty rain, snow, hail, and powerful winds can cause harm to the roof, leading to leaks. Lousy installation of roofing products might also lead to gaps and weak places that enable water to penetrate the roof. Last but not least, lack of standard maintenance may result in the accumulation of debris, moss, and algae to the roof, which might induce injury and lead to leaks.
In an effort to prevent roof leaks, it can be crucial to comprehend the results in and consider proactive actions to deal with them. Normal inspections and servicing can help recognize probable issues just before they develop into major difficulties. By knowledge the results in of roof leaks, homeowners may take measures to forestall them and make sure the longevity in their roof.
Frequent Maintenance and Inspection
Normal upkeep and inspection are essential for avoiding roof leaks. It is necessary to inspect the roof at the least two times a 12 months, while in the spring and slide, to look for any indicators of damage or put on. In the course of the inspection, it is necessary to look for missing or broken shingles or tiles, cracks, gaps, and areas of wear. Additionally, it is important to look for indications of drinking water injury inside the home, which include h2o stains about the ceiling or walls, which can suggest a roof leak.
Besides standard inspections, it is vital to carry out plan servicing within the roof. This includes cleansing gutters and downspouts to make certain proper drainage, eliminating particles for example leaves and branches in the roof, and trimming overhanging tree branches that can cause damage to the roof. By being proactive with standard maintenance and inspections, homeowners can discover and address probable problems in advance of they result in high-priced roof leaks.
Repairing Harmed Shingles or Tiles
One widespread cause of roof leaks is ruined shingles or tiles. Eventually, shingles can become cracked, curled, or missing, that may permit drinking water to seep in the roof. It's important to often inspect the roof for virtually any signs of broken shingles or tiles and deal with them immediately to circumvent leaks.
To repair broken shingles or tiles, start off by diligently removing the broken pieces and replacing them with new ones. It is vital to work with a similar variety of shingle or tile to ensure a proper match and seal. In addition, it is vital to check for any underlying harm to the roof deck or underlayment and handle any challenges right before changing the shingles or tiles. By on a regular basis inspecting and fixing destroyed shingles or tiles, homeowners can avert roof leaks and ensure the integrity of their roof.

Setting up a Waterproof Membrane
Together with roof sealant, setting up a waterproof membrane can provide extra security against roof leaks. A water-proof membrane is a skinny layer of fabric that is applied on to the roof deck in advance of shingles or tiles are mounted. This membrane functions as being a barrier in opposition to drinking water penetration and can help reduce leaks.
To install a water-resistant membrane, commence by cleaning the roof deck totally to eliminate any Dust or particles. Then, utilize the membrane in overlapping levels, ensuring that to produce a limited seal all-around vents, chimneys, skylights, and other vulnerable areas. It is crucial to Adhere to the maker's Recommendations for set up and be certain that the membrane is appropriately secured on the roof deck. By putting in a water-resistant membrane, homeowners can include an extra layer of security from leaks and prolong the existence of their roof.
Addressing Flashing and Air flow Difficulties
Flashing and air flow issues may also lead to roof leaks. Flashing is a thin strip of fabric that is certainly installed around vents, chimneys, skylights, and various protrusions about the roof to create a watertight seal. Over time, flashing may become broken or deteriorate, bringing about gaps that let water to seep by. Furthermore, poor air flow within the attic may lead to moisture buildup, that may lead to harm to the roof deck and underlayment.
